m.Stock MTF, or Margin Trading Facility, allows eligible investors to purchase supported securities by paying part of the transaction value while the broker provides funding for the eligible balance. This can increase an investor's purchasing power, but it also introduces funding costs, margin requirements, and additional financial risk.
Under an MTF arrangement, the investor provides the required margin and the broker finances the remaining eligible amount. The securities purchased through the facility are subject to applicable regulatory and broker-specific requirements. The amount of funding available can vary according to the security, market conditions, applicable regulations, and current m.Stock terms.
One of the primary advantages of MTF is increased market exposure. An investor with a limited amount of available capital may be able to take a larger position in an eligible security. However, leverage works in both directions. A favourable price movement can increase potential gains, while an adverse movement can magnify losses relative to the investor's own capital.
m.Stock MTF charges are an important factor when considering the facility. Funding or interest charges may apply to the amount financed by the broker. The applicable rate, calculation method, and billing terms depend on the current pricing structure. Investors should calculate the expected funding cost before opening an MTF position.
Margin requirements must also be monitored throughout the position. If the value of the underlying security falls, the available margin may decline. The investor may then need to provide additional funds or eligible securities to maintain the required margin.
If sufficient margin is not maintained, the broker may take action according to the applicable MTF terms. This can include requesting additional margin or liquidating eligible positions. Investors should therefore monitor their positions and available margin rather than assuming that an MTF position can remain open indefinitely.
The holding period is another important consideration. Funding costs can accumulate while an MTF position remains open. A trade that appears profitable based solely on the change in share price may produce a smaller net return after funding charges and other applicable transaction costs.
Investors should also consider the volatility of the security being purchased. A highly volatile stock can experience significant price movements over a short period. When leverage is involved, such movements can have a greater effect on the investor's available capital and margin position.
MTF should not be considered a guaranteed-return strategy. It is a leveraged trading facility intended for investors who understand the associated costs and risks. Investors should have sufficient financial capacity to meet additional margin requirements if the market moves against their position.

MTF lets you buy more shares than your cash balance by borrowing the rest from the broker, for delivery trades only. You pay daily interest on the borrowed amount and pledge the purchased shares as collateral.
